1. Install "pyotherside-tests" package

This tutorial shows how to install pyotherside-tests on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install pyotherside-tests

2. Uninstall "pyotherside-tests" package

This guide covers the steps necessary to uninstall pyotherside-tests on Debian 11 (Bullseye):

$ sudo apt remove pyotherside-tests $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
